note: I've been using this quite a while and it works great. I also found that the fan is not necessary at all, just the desiccant works perfect. In my environment I just drain out the desiccant once a month, dry it per manufacturers recommendation, and put it back it. Easy Peasy.
Here is my single dry spool holder for my Prusa Mk3 or can be used as a attachment to the side of a larger container to make changing the desiccant much easier. This presentation focuses on the adding of it directly to the Prusa MK3 for one spool.
This project was a natural outcome of making the 5 gallon storage moisture sensor. I looked at a number of different methods and thought I would try something that is maybe a little more complicated but simpler to use and doesn't take up any more space.
It uses the bottom half of a $4 dollar Lowes bucket https://www.lowes.com/pd/Encore-Plastics-5-Gallon-General-Bucket/1000309157and a ring with a 1/8 or 3mm o-ring for a seal. The desiccant is held in a printed container with a viewing window with space for a 50mm fan to draw air over the desiccant.

The Fusion 360 file https://a360.co/3jyALCo for the ring is included with the formula to calculate diameter for different heights. Go into parameters to change the diameter.
I've included a DXF file for cutouts to the end cover. I've included to mount to the side of a bucket and a small file to mount the Moisture sensor listed almost flush to the cover. Enough room is left to allow changing the battery.
